On December 5, BlackRock submitted its S-1 filing to the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) for the iShares Staked Ethereum Trust (ETHB). This follows the fund’s earlier registration in Delaware on November 19 — a move that initially sparked industry speculation but is now confirmed with the formal SEC submission.
